使用 Dapper 进行快速高效的查询
原文约400字/词,阅读约需2分钟。
📝
内容提要
Dapper 是一个轻量级微型 ORM,适合需要更多 SQL 控制或性能优化的场景。本文介绍了如何在 SQLite 中使用 Dapper 执行查询并将结果映射到 C# 对象。示例代码展示了创建表、插入数据和查询结果。Dapper 易用、灵活且性能优越。
🎯
关键要点
-
Dapper 是一个轻量级微型 ORM,适合需要更多 SQL 控制或性能优化的场景。
-
Dapper 允许快速高效地执行 SQL 查询,并提供轻量级的对象映射。
-
使用 Dapper 需要安装 NuGet 包:Dapper 和 Microsoft.Data.Sqlite。
-
示例代码展示了如何在 SQLite 中创建表、插入数据和查询结果。
-
代码中使用 Dapper 执行 SQL 查询,创建表、插入产品并查询所有产品。
-
Dapper 提供了易用性、灵活性和优越的性能,是理想的微型 ORM 选择。
❓
延伸问答
Dapper 是什么?
Dapper 是一个轻量级微型 ORM,适合需要更多 SQL 控制或性能优化的场景。
如何在 SQLite 中使用 Dapper 执行查询?
在 SQLite 中使用 Dapper 执行查询需要安装 Dapper 和 Microsoft.Data.Sqlite 的 NuGet 包,然后通过创建连接、执行 SQL 语句来实现。
Dapper 的性能如何?
Dapper 提供优越的性能,适合需要快速高效执行 SQL 查询的场景。
使用 Dapper 进行数据映射的过程是怎样的?
使用 Dapper 进行数据映射时,可以通过 Query 方法将查询结果直接映射到 C# 对象,例如将数据库中的产品信息映射到产品类。
Dapper 的主要优点是什么?
Dapper 的主要优点包括易用性、灵活性和优越的性能,是理想的微型 ORM 选择。
如何在 Dapper 中插入数据?
在 Dapper 中插入数据可以使用 Execute 方法,例如通过 SQL 语句插入产品信息。
🏷️